自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 收藏
  • 关注

原创 java Script 总结

一.js入门 1.1 介绍 ​ JavaScript是一种具有函数优先的轻量级,解释型或即时编译型的编程语言。虽然它是作为Web页面的脚本语言而出名,但是它也被用到了很多非浏览器环境中,JavaScript基于原型编程,多范式的动态脚本语言,并且支持面向对象,命令式和声明式(如函数式编程)风格。 1.2 主要功能 嵌入动态文本于HTML页面。 对浏览器事件做出响应。 读写HTML元素 在数据被提交到服务器之前对数据进行校验 检测访客的浏览器信息。控制cookies,包括创建和修改等。 基于Node.j

2021-07-23 21:08:05 938

原创 Thread_线程类

1.线程和进程的区别 进程:由系统资源分配和调度的最小单元,而线程依赖于进程存在,程序执行的最小单位! 如果创建线程----必须有进程----->创建系统资源 Java语言不能够创建系统资源, 借助于底层语言C语言来操作 Java提供类Thread类 借助于Thread类如何实现 线程的创建? 并发:在一个时间点同时发生 并行:在一个时间段内同时发生 开发步骤: ​ 1)自定义一个类 继承自 Thread(线程 是程序中的执行线程。Java 虚拟机允许应 ​

2021-05-27 21:33:01 167

原创 BigDecimal类

1.Java提供一个中小数精确计算的类 构造方法: public BigDecimal(String val) *字段: public static final int ROUND_HALF_UP:舍入模式:四舍五入 成员方法: public BigDecimal add(BigDecimal augend) :加法运算 public BigDecimal substract(BigDecimal augend):减法 public BigDecimal mul

2021-05-27 20:56:47 131

原创 匿名内部类

1.匿名内部类 ​ 定义:经常在局部位置使用, ​ 格式: ​ new 接口/抽象类(){ 重写抽象方法 } 本质: ​ 是继承了该抽象类或者是接口的子实现类的对象。 interface Inter{ void show() ; } class Outer{ //补全代码 public static Inter method(){ return new Inter(){ @Override publi

2021-05-27 20:55:15 112

原创 代码块

代码块 一.定义;在java中用{ }包裹起来的代码都称为代码块。 二. 代码块的分类: ​ 局部代码块: ​ 在局部的位置(方法定义中){ },限定局部变量的生命周期,不能超过这个范围访问 构造代码块: ​ 在类的成员位置中使用{ } 包裹起来的代码, ​ 作用将多个构造方法中相同的代码存储在构造代码块中,在执行构造方法之前先执行,对数据进行初始化! ​ 特点:在每次执行构造方法之前,如果存在构造代码块,则优先执行构造代码块,再执行构造方法! 静态代码块: ​ 在类成员的位置: ​ 静态随着

2021-05-18 20:25:03 110

原创 形参与返回值问题

1.形式参数; ​ 基本数据类型:实际传递的是当前这个数据值! ​ 引用数据类型: ​ 数组:需要传递数组对象 ​ 类:具体类:传递的是当前类的对象 ​ 抽象数据类型: ​ 传递的是当前抽象类的子类对象(抽象多态) ​ 接口数据类型: ​ 传递的是当前接口类的子实现类对象(接口多态) class Demo{ public int add(int a,int b){ //形式参数:基本数据类型 return a + b; } }

2021-05-15 08:43:40 725 2

原创 static关键字

static关键字 1) 简介 Java中提供了一个关键字:static 可以被多个对象“共享”“共用”, 在需要共享的对象前加入这个属性。 //定义一个类:人类 class Person{//Preson.class private String name ; //姓名 private int age ; //年龄 static String country ;//国籍 //有参构造方法 //带两个参数的构造方法 public Person(String name,

2021-05-14 18:41:09 94

原创 面向对象

面向对象 1.面向对象的思想 ​ 面向对象是基于面向过程的! ​ 面向过程: ​ 从需求到分析,从业务逻辑到结果输出,整个过程都是自己完成(什么活都是自己亲力亲为,执 行者) ​ 需求: 键盘录入三个数据,使用功能改进,求三个数据中最大值! ​ 1)分析:导包 ​ 2)创建键盘录入对象Scanner ​ 3)提示并录入数据 ​ 4)定义一个功能(方法) ​ 4.1)分析:明确返回值类型/明确

2021-05-14 08:45:24 128

原创 java中常见的运算符

1.逻辑运算符 &&(逻辑双与),||(逻辑双或) 逻辑双与&&和逻辑单与& 共同点:当多个条件,有一个不满足,就不成立! 并列关系 有false,则false 逻辑单与&:无论符号左边的表达式是true还是false,右边都需要执行! 逻辑双与&&: 具有短路效果! 如果符号左...

2021-04-30 21:30:48 168 1

原创 跳转控制语句

跳转控制语句 break ; continue ; return ; 1.break; 表示中断结束的意思,不能单独场景使用 只能在这两个场景使用: switch语句 :遇见break结束 循环中使用:结束循环语句的单个循环语句中嵌套循环中使用(早期的) break 标签语句 ...

2021-04-30 21:05:22 245 1

原创 while循环

1.while循环的通用格式 初始化语句; while(条件表达式){ 循环体语句; 控制体语句; } *执行流程 初始化语句:给变量进行赋值 当前条件表达式成立,执行循环体语句; 继续控制体语句, 再次执行条件表达式 ... ... 当条件表达式不满足条件,while循环结束 注意事项: while循环在使用的时候不要忘了控制体语句,否则死循环 ...

2021-04-30 20:45:43 388 1

原创 For循环

for循环的格式: for(1)初始化语句;2)条件语句;4)步长语句(控制体语句)){ 3)循环体语句; } 流程: 1)初始语句给当前循环中的变量赋值:执行一次 2)接下来执行条件语句,判断条件语句是否成立 3)如果条件语句结果成立:true,执行3)循环体语句 4)执行控制体语...

2021-04-30 20:12:04 153

原创 关于超链接的一些总结

一,超链接的一些作用 作为传统的“页面跳转”使用 要么执行的为本地文件协议:file:// 要么执行的是http协议:联网发送请求 总结 执行流程: 当前用户发送http请求需要在解析域名:首先在本地计算计的 C:Windows/system32/drive...

2021-04-26 20:34:31 834

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除